1、行 遍 性 问 题撰写:刘伟 董小刚 林玎 制作:李慧玲 李刚健吉林建工学院基础科学系行 遍 性 问 题一、中 国 邮 递 员 问 题二、推 销 员 问 题三、建模案例:最佳灾情巡视路线(一) 欧 拉 图(二) 中 国 邮 递 员 问 题(一) 哈 密 尔 顿 图(二) 推 销 员 问 题V7e3v1 v2v3v4e1e2e4 e5V5V6e6e7 e8e9割边G的边 e是割边的充要条件是 e不含在 G的圈中割边的定义 :设 G连通, e E(G),若从 G中删除边 e后,图 G-e不连通,则称边 e为图 G的割边e3v1 v2v3v4e1e2e4 e5e6欧 拉 图e3v1 v2v3v4e1
2、e2e4 e5巡回: v1e1v2e2v3e5v1e4v4e3v3e5v1欧拉道路: v1e1v2e2v3e5v1e4v4e3v3 欧拉巡回:v1e1v2e2v3e5v1e4v4e3v3e6v1e3v1 v2v3v4e1e2e4 e5e3v1 v2v3v4e1e2e4 e5e6欧拉图 非欧拉图返回中国邮递员问题 -定义中国邮递员问题 -算法Fleury算法 -基本思想 :从任一点出发,每当访问一条边时,先要进行检查如果可供访问的边不只一条,则应选一条不是未访问的边集的导出子图的割边 作为访问边,直到没有边可选择为止 .V7e3v1 v2v3v4e1e2e4 e5V5V6e6e7 e8e9e10若 G不是欧拉图,则 G的任何一个巡回经过某些边必定多于一次解决这类问题的一般方法是,在一些点对之间引入重复边(重复边与它平行的边具有相同的权),使原图成为欧拉图,但希望所有添加的重复边的权的总和为最小